Biodiversity Week 2026

From a dawn chorus sunrise to a bat walk at night, from woodlands to wetlands and from talks to screenings across Wicklow and north Wexford, join us this Biodiversity Week for a fascinating series of events showcasing the rich biodiversity of our region!
